Frequently Asked Questions
Which breed is better for families with children?
Both breeds are good with kids, making them suitable for families.
How long do these breeds typically live?
The British Shorthair can live 12-20 years, while the American Shorthair typically lives 12-15 years.
Are they good for first-time cat owners?
Yes, both breeds are considered good for first-time owners.
Do they require a lot of exercise?
The British Shorthair has moderate exercise needs, while the American Shorthair has slightly higher exercise needs.
How do they handle being alone?
The British Shorthair can stay alone for longer periods compared to the American Shorthair.
